In 1998, the Vatican opened the archives kept by the Ministry of the Holy Order to 30 scholars from all over the world. The scholars eventually wrote an 800-page report and held a press conference in Rome to make it public. Their conclusion: Many of those sent to the Spanish Inquisition received fair trials, torture was uncommon, and only about 1% of them were executed.
